Demonstration of new style lifesaving jackets, London
Jul. 07, 1959 - Demonstration of New Style Lifesaving Jackets in London: A demonstration was held at the Royal Festival Hall this afternoon of new Marksway Lifesaving Jackets'. They are foolproof, for no action is needed by the users from babies to old folk. Buoyancy comes from air trapped inside the lining. Panels of Long staples fiber cotton are let into otherwise airtight compartments that form part of the lining. When dry, air circulates freely - when wet the cloth seals up promptly to become both air and water tight - and they are so designed that there can be no leakage of air.
